Email System of IIS
Mail Server Settings of IIS
POP3/IMAP server: mail.iis.sinica.edu.tw
POP3, IMAP, POP3s, IMAPs mail services are available in IIS networks.
Only POP3s and IMAPs are avaiable outside of IIS networks.
Outgoing(SMTP) server: mail.iis.sinica.edu.tw
SMTP and SMTPs are available in IIS networks. Only SMTPs is avaiable
outside of IIS networks.
Mail address: username@iis.sinica.edu.tw. "username" is your account
name.
Format of Email Address
- Domain Name
The address is in the format of username@iis.sinica.edu.tw
username->your account
iis->Institute of Information Science
sinica->Academia Sinica
edu->educational institute
tw->Taiwan
If the receiver is in the same domain as yours, the domain can be
omitted.
For example, if you send to adm@iis.sinica.edu.tw, the address can be
abbreviated as adm@iis.
On the other hand, if you send to John in UIUC, the address cannot be
abbreviated and needs to be john@uxa.cso.uiuc.edu
- IP
Another type of format uses IP address, such as
username@\[ip_address\]. For example if you send to hsu in the computer
center, the address can be hsu@\[140.109.14.2\].
Auto-Forwarding
Auto-forwarding helps you forward the mails in your iis
mailbox to your other accounts. This can be set in the auto-forwarding
function on webmail.
- Log in to webmail
- Spread "mail", and click on "forwards"
- Input the other email address to "Set/install a forward to"
- Check "Keep a copy in your local mailbox?" to save the email
also in
your mailbox. (The system will ask you to enter your password when you
save the setting for confirmation.)
Auto-Reply
When you are abroad or on a vacation, the system can help
you reply the mails. Please use webmail to set up this function.
- Log in to webmail
- Spread "mail", and click on "Vacation"
- Input the subject, from, message that you would like to reply.
(The system will ask you to enter your password when you save the
setting for confirmation.)
